You can get a rough estimate by finding first the average point total of any one card and multiplying it by 3: The total number of points in the deck is
4(1+2+3+....+9+10+10+10+10)=340, so the average per card is 340/52=6.54.
For three cards drawn from three complete decks, you would have on average 3(6.54)=19.6 points.
However, your three cards come from the same deck, and this where it gets tricky. Drawing the first card will effect the average points of the remaining 51 cards: for example, if you drew a king (of value 10) first, then the average point number for the second card will be lower than 6.54 (it would be (340-10)/51=6.47).
To find the exact answer, you would have to go through all possibilities ( (king, 7, 8), (ace,5,10), etc.) and calculate the value, then find the average. I suspect it would still be close to 19.6.
